Warning Signs You Need Sump Pump Failure Water Removal

Catching these signs early can save you thousands of dollars in repairs and prevent bigger problems down the line. Don’t ignore these warning signs: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Strong, unpleasant odors in your basement or crawlspace can show a sump pump failure. If you notice musty smells that persist even after cleaning, it’s time to call us.

Water Stains on Walls and Ceilings

Water stains on your walls and ceilings can be a sign of a sump pump failure. If you notice discoloration or water marks, it’s essential to act quickly to prevent further damage.

Water Accumulation in the Basement

Standing water in your basement or crawlspace is a clear sign of a sump pump failure. If you notice water accumulating, don’t wait, call us immediately.

Warped or Buckled Floors

Warped or buckled floors can be a sign of water damage caused by a sump pump failure. If you notice any changes in your floors, it’s crucial to address the issue quickly.

Mold and Mildew Growth

Mold and mildew growth can thrive in damp environments, making it a sign of a sump pump failure. If you notice any signs of mold or mildew, don’t hesitate to contact us.

Unusual Sounds or Leaks

Unusual sounds or leaks from your sump pump can show a failure. If you notice any unusual noises or water leaks, it’s time to call us.

Sump Pump Failure Water Removal v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small water spill (less than 100 sq. Ft.) Yes No You can likely handle a small spill yourself, but be sure to act quickly to prevent further damage.
Water accumulation in a large area (over 500 sq. Ft.) No Yes A large water accumulation needs specialized equipment and expertise to safely and effectively remove the water and repair any damage.
Visible signs of mold or mildew growth No Yes Mold and mildew growth can be hazardous to your health, and only a professional can safely and effectively remediate the issue.
Water damage to electrical parts or appliances No Yes Water damage to electrical parts or appliances can be a serious safety hazard and needs the expertise of a professional to safely repair or replace.
Water damage to structural parts (walls, floors, etc.) No Yes Water damage to structural parts can compromise the integrity of your home and needs the expertise of a professional to safely and effectively repair.

Sump Pump Failure Water Removal Cost in Horsham, PA

The cost of sump pump failure water removal in Horsham, PA, varies based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. These estimates are based on our experience and may not reflect the actual cost of your specific job. Our team will provide a detailed estimate after inspecting your property.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Initial Inspection and Assessment $100 – $500 The size of the affected area and the severity of the damage
Water Removal $500 – $2,500 The volume of water to be removed and the equipment required
Drying and Dehumidification $500 – $2,000 The size of the affected area and the number of dehumidifiers required
Repair and Reconstruction $1,000 – $5,000 The extent of the damage and the materials required for repairs
Final Inspection and Cleaning $100 – $500 The size of the affected area and the level of cleaning required

Q: How do I prevent sump pump failure in the future?

A: To prevent sump pump failure, ensure your sump pump is regularly inspected and maintained, and consider installing a backup sump pump or a battery-powered sump pump in case of a power outage.
